XPSPEAK 4.1 remains a reliable, "old-school" favorite for researchers who need a straightforward, free tool for deconvolution without the high cost of commercial suites like CasaXPS. While newer open-source alternatives like are becoming popular for their updated features, XPSPEAK is still frequently cited in modern peer-reviewed literature for its core fitting accuracy.
